Don’t Forget to Make Payroll Updates for Life Insurance

A reminder to those cooperatives that utilize a payroll system to deduct premiums from employees’ paychecks for life insurance premiums: You may need to update those systems to reflect the plan changes for 2021. Depending on your cooperative’s elections and how it covers premiums for spouse and child life, updates may be needed to account for:

  • A basic life benefit maximum of $1.5 million (if elected by the co-op)
  • Additional spouse life coverage options of $150,000 and $200,000
  • Additional child life coverage option of $20,000
